3-Benzoyl-7-methoxycoumarin

Details

Top
Internal ID d51e804f-6bdd-40f1-ae7c-decb5c13a815
Taxonomy Organic oxygen compounds > Organooxygen compounds > Carbonyl compounds > Phenylketones > Aryl-phenylketones
IUPAC Name 3-benzoyl-7-methoxychromen-2-one
SMILES (Canonical) COC1=CC2=C(C=C1)C=C(C(=O)O2)C(=O)C3=CC=CC=C3
SMILES (Isomeric) COC1=CC2=C(C=C1)C=C(C(=O)O2)C(=O)C3=CC=CC=C3
InChI InChI=1S/C17H12O4/c1-20-13-8-7-12-9-14(17(19)21-15(12)10-13)16(18)11-5-3-2-4-6-11/h2-10H,1H3
InChI Key HYORIVUCOQKMOC-UHFFFAOYSA-N
Popularity 9 references in papers

Physical and Chemical Properties

Top
Molecular Formula C17H12O4
Molecular Weight 280.27 g/mol
Exact Mass 280.07355886 g/mol
Topological Polar Surface Area (TPSA) 52.60 Ų
XlogP 3.40
Atomic LogP (AlogP) 3.03
H-Bond Acceptor 4
H-Bond Donor 0
Rotatable Bonds 3
